Muscat grapes are a type of European and Asian grapes, originated in the United Kingdom, and are a variety of local grapes in China. ** 1. Fruit's characteristics ** 1. ** Ear and fruit ** - The ear was conical and medium in size. The average ear weight was 350 grams, and the big ones could reach more than 500 grams. The largest ear weight could reach about 1000 grams. The fruit is loose to medium tight. The fruit is oval or ovoid, with an average weight of 5 grams and a maximum weight of 6.2 grams. It is dark purple-red, with a medium thickness of skin and thick fruit powder. The flesh is yellow-green, soft and juicy. 2. ** Quality * - It was sweet and had a strong rose fragrance. The fruit contained 18 - 20% sugar content, 15% - 20% dissolved solid content, and 0.5% - 0.7% acid content. The fresh quality was extremely good. The brewed wine was of average quality. The wine had a typical fruit fragrance, but it was not easy to age. ** 2. Planting Techniques ** 1. ** Seedlings selection and treatment ** - Choose an annual seedling with good growth, at least 0.4 cm thick, with more than 5 lateral roots and 3 - 5 full buds on the side branches. Soak the roots of the seedlings in clear water for 12 - 24 hours (soaking 1 - 2 days before planting), so that the roots can absorb water before planting. 2. ** Planting ** - When planting, dig a trench and plant it with the original soil ball. Let the roots spread out in the soil and bury them all. After planting, press the surrounding soil and water it in time. In water-poor areas, the fruit trees were cultivated every year to deepen their roots and improve their drought tolerance. ** 3. Management Techniques ** 1. ** Water and fertilizer management ** - Before sprouting, apply 30 - 40kg of diaminium orthonate and 15 - 20kg of carbamine per mu; before blooming, apply 20 - 30kg of diaminium orthonate; spray 0.3 - 0.5% of Borax solution at the beginning of flowering stage; spray 0.2 - 0.3% of Monobium Phosphates solution after the berries are colored; spray once every 7 days for 3 - 4 times in a row. Water the soil appropriately every time you apply fertilizer to keep the soil slightly moist. 2. ** Trimmed and wiped ** - The growth state of the plant was stable, and the new leaves on the branches were trimmed appropriately. In the year of fruit hanging, he should pick the heart in time and repeatedly, cut off the secondary shoots, repair the ears of flowers, and leave 1 - 2 ears for each fruit branch. The secondary shoots under the ear were completely wiped off from the base, and the secondary shoots above the ear were left with 1 - 2 leaves before being pinched in time. 3. ** Whole panicle covered ** - Remove 1/5 - 1/4 of the ear tip, insect grains, and deformed grains. Bag the ear with a paper bag with good ventilation. Before sheathing, spray disinfectant such as carbendazim on the ear. Remove the paper bag 10 days before harvesting. 4. ** Harvest at the right time ** - It was best to harvest the fruits after they were ripe in the morning or evening. During the harvesting process, it was best to avoid man-made damage to the fruits and cut off the sick and insect grains. 5. ** Clean the garden to prevent cold ** - Clean up the orchard thoroughly, trim the insect branches and old branches, clean up the weeds, fallen leaves, and fallen fruits, and bury them deep in the distance or burn them in a concentrated manner. From mid-November to early winter, the branches and vines were removed from the shelves, tied up, and buried to prevent cold. ** 4. Method to identify quality ** 1. ** Appearance ** - The fruit stem should be green and fresh, the fruit surface and fruit powder should be complete, and the skin color should be bright without spots. The fruit stem is moldy and rusted, the fruit powder is incomplete, the peel is withered and dark, and the fruit surface is wet or has brown spots, which is not fresh. The fruit should be plump, uniform in size and mature appropriately. 2. ** Fruit Growth Status ** - You can pick up the main stalk of the ear and shake it slightly. The fruit grains are firm and fresh. If the grains fall down one after another, it means that they have been stored for a long time. 3. ** Taste and identify ** - The meat was crispy and tender, with a lot of fruit pulp and a little sourness. Those with rose or strawberry fragrance were top-grade, while the meat was like a "leather ring", with little sweetness and more sourness. ** 5. Other characteristics ** 1. ** Growth characteristic ** - The growth of the plant is medium, the second fruit rate is high, and the yield is high. The requirements for fertilizer and water and management techniques were relatively high. Under the conditions of sufficient fertilizer and water quality and proper cultivation and management measures, the yield was high and the quality was good. On the contrary, it was easy to produce flower and fruit dropping and big and small grains. The ears were loose and easy to suffer from the "water jar" disease. The technical measures such as pinching the tip of the ear before blooming should be taken to ensure the quality. The disease resistance was moderate. It was suitable for cultivation in the shed and hedgerow frame. Medium and short shoot trimming should be used. 2. ** Range of distribution ** - The planting area in the world was very wide, especially in European countries. It was mainly planted in Beijing and other places in China. It was also planted in Turpan, Shandong, Yunnan and other places in Xinjiang. It could be developed in the north of the Yellow River. Are Japanese muscat grapes sunshine roses?
No, it wasn't. Sunshine Rose was a diploid European and American hybrid species, native to Japan. It was easy to cultivate, had crisp and hard meat, and had the fragrance of roses.
